Employees

Twoway considers its employees its most important asset and is committed to providing a respectful, safe, healthy, and inclusive workplace free from discrimination and harassment. We believe that employee loyalty and engagement are the foundation of long-term competitiveness. Accordingly, Twoway offers market-competitive compensation and comprehensive benefits, along with structured learning programs and career rotation opportunities based on individual abilities and professional expertise. To better understand employee needs, the Company has established multiple two-way communication channels to ensure that employee voices are heard and addressed.

 

Employee Communication Channels

  • Written communication with the Human Resources Department by mail or email

  • Ad-hoc meetings to raise concerns or provide feedback

  • Employee Welfare Committee meetings

  • Cross-level and cross-department communication channels

Suppliers

Twoway conducts all business transactions with suppliers in accordance with the principles of integrity, fairness, and good faith. Neither party may directly or indirectly offer, promise, request, or accept improper benefits, nor engage in any illegal, dishonest, or unethical conduct. Both parties are also prohibited from manipulating, concealing, or misusing information obtained through business activities to engage in unfair transactions or misrepresent material facts, thereby protecting the legitimate rights and interests of all parties involved.
